Directive Speech Acts in The Short Film “Makr” by Hana Kazim (George Yule`s Pragmatic Study)
This research discusses directive speech acts in the short film Makr. A directive speech act is a type of speech act that is used by the speaker to order the hearer to do something. The aim of this research is to describe the forms and functions of directive speech acts in films. The method used is...
